EZ MULTIDROP M Revision 1 5 Outline Dimensions Side View All dimensions are provided in inches and millimeters mm are in 4 265 108 331 1 544 39 210 6 EZ MULTIDROP M Revision 1 HARDWARE EMI Noise Filter Installation EZText Panels and the EZ Multiplexer are supplied with two ferrite cores that should be attached to the cables prior to installation of the EZText Panel These cores are required to suppress EMI emissions that are conducted through the Power Cable and the Communications Cable The figure below shows the ferrite cores properly installed Attach the cores within one inch of the EZText connector The cable should be snugly wrapped once around the core providing two passes through the core The Power Cable Core is a solid ferrite cylinder The Power Cable should pass once through the core be looped around and pass through a second time Pull the excess cable so that it rests snugly against the outside of the core The Communications Cable Core is a snap together split ferrite core This core can be installed on a finished cable Lift the latch to open the core Wrap the wire through the core center snugly around the outside and again through the center Close the core until the latch snaps Ensure that the cable jacket is not pinched between the two halves of the core The finished cable should look similar to the drawing shown below eee POWER PLUG Communications Cable Power Cable

RS 232C EZ MULTIDROP M Revision 1 11 i HARDWARE 12 Above the PLC PROG port are two LEDs that indicate communication between the Multiplexer and PLC or between the Multiplexer and a programming computer 1 TXD Transmit Green LED when illuminated indicates that the port is sending data 1 RXD Receive Red LED when illuminated indicates that the port is receiving data EZText Panel Ports COM1 COM2 COM3 COM4 and COM5 There are five 9 position male D Sub Connectors operating in RS 422A mode at a fixed Baud Rate These ports are used for connection for up to five of any EZText Panel including the Set Point Panel EZ 220 EZ 220L EZ 420 EZ 220P EZ SP Use Belden 9729 or equivalent one per panel to connect panels to COM ports A wiring diagram for the cable is shown below EZ MULTIPLEXER EZText Panel 9 RD 1 CHASSIS 9 Pin Female D Sub 15 Pin Male D Sub COM1 COM2 COM3 COM4 and COM5 Port LEDs TXD and RXD Above each EZText Panel port COM1 COM2 COM3 COM4 and COMS are two LEDs that indicate communication between the PLC and the EZText Panels 5 TXD Transmit Green LED when illuminated indicates that the port is sending data 5 RXD Receive Red LED when illuminated indicates that the port is receiving data ERROR LED The ERROR LED indicates an error with the PLC when in Multiplexer run Mode or it indicates an error with the Multiplexer s internal firmware EXEC when in

Program setup Mode It also flashes when switching between modes e When the EZ Multiplexer enters the Multiplexer Mode the ERROR LED will blink on for 100 Msec and off for 100 Msec 5 times EZ MULTIDROP M Revision 1 HARDWARE e When the EZ Multiplexer enters the Program Mode the ERROR LED will blink on for 400 Msec and off for 100 Msec 2 times While the EZ Multiplexer is in Multiplexer Mode Run Mode the red ERROR LED will illuminate to indicate an error with the PLC The ERROR LED will illuminate for 2 seconds and then turn off while the PLC driver tries to communicate with the PLC again If there was an error with the PLC the PLC message will be displayed on all of the EZText Panels that are connected and communicating with the EZ Multiplexer e When the Multiplexer Panel is in Program Mode either because the EZText Programming Software is sending new firmware or because on power up the Boot found that there is an invalid EXEC the ERROR LED will blink on for 1 second and off for 200 Msec continuously YOU MUST reload the firmware ensuring you have the correct firmware hex file POWER LED The Power LED illuminates when power is applied to the unit Mode Switch This switch allows you to switch the EZ Multiplexer between Programming setup Mode and Multiplexer run Mode PLC Terminator Resistor Switch Used to switch the RS 422 RS 485 termination resistor ON or OFF If the EZ Multiplexer is the first or last node

RROR LED is illuminated The ERROR LED indicates an error with the PLC when in Multiplexer run Mode or it indicates an error with the Multiplexer s internal firmware EXEC when in Program setup Mode It also flashes when switching between modes e When the EZ Multiplexer enters the Multiplexer Mode the ERROR LED will blink on for 100 Msec and off for 100 Msec 5 times This is normal e When the EZ Multiplexer enters the Program Mode the ERROR LED will blink on for 400 Msec and off for 100 Msec 2 times This is normal e While the EZ Multiplexer is in Multiplexer Mode Run Mode the red ERROR LED will illuminate to indicate an error with the PLC The ERROR LED will illuminate for 2 seconds and then turn off while the PLC driver tries to communicate with the PLC again If there was an error with the PLC the PLC message will be displayed on all of the EZText Panels that are connected and communicating with the EZ Multiplexer See Problem Multiplexer is not communicating with PLC When the Multiplexer Panel is in Program Mode either because the EZText Programming Software is sending new firmware or because on power up the Boot found that there is an invalid EXEC the ERROR LED will blink on for 1 second and off for 200 Msec continuously YOU MUST reload the firmware ensuring you have the correct firmware hex file See section on installation of new firmware this manual 16 EZ MULTIDROP M Revision 1 TROUBLESHOOTING Still n

11. ation master unit and was designed to allow up to 5 EZText Panels to communicate with a single PLC You may connect 5 of any combination of EZText Panels including the EZ SP Set Point Panel You will program each panel separately in your EZText Programming Software Version 2 0 Multi Panel System project After you select Multi Panel System in the programming software you will select an EZText Panel connected to Port 1 Port 2 Port 3 Port 4 or Port 5 and configure it individually Each EZText Panel in a Multi Panel System may have a unique configuration Only the PLC settings are common to all five panels When creating a Multi Panel Project you can import a panel configuration from an existing project file or export it to another project file It is important to note that the EZ Multiplexer will only read and write to PLC registers that the panels are currently monitoring This significantly increases the speed and performance of a Multi Panel System The same port PLC Programming Port is used for connection to either the PLC or a programming computer A MODE switch on the front of the unit see figure on page 10 allows you to select PROGRAM setup Mode or MULTIPLEXER run Mode You will use PROGRAM Mode MODE switch is ON when Programming connected to a computer and MULTIPLEXER Mode MODE switch is OFF when connected to a PLC You will use cable P N EZTEXT PGMCBL to connect the Multiplexer to a programming computer Abov

13. e the PLC PROG port are two LEDs that indicate communication between the Multiplexer and PLC or between the Multiplexer and a programming computer There are 5 panel ports used to connect to any of the EZText Panel models Above each EZText Panel port COM1 COM2 COM3 COM4 and COMB5 are two LEDs that indicate communication between the Multiplexer and the EZText Panels The PLC Attribute settings are the same for each Panel The baud rate to each of the panels is fixed The Multiplexer supports the same PLCs as the EZText Panel All of the EZText Panels in a project are configured to use the same PLC driver to communicate with the Multiplexer this is done automatically by EZText Programming Software Version 2 0 Version 2 0 of the software will support downloading the PLC driver retrieving information from the Multiplexer revision and PLC attributes and setting the PLC Attributes For information about Multi Panel configuration see the EZText Programming Software Getting Started Manual Version 2 0 that ships with the software CD P N EZ TEXTEDIT EZ MULTIDROP M Revision 1 1 INTRODUCTION An EZText Panel will request read the values of the PLC Addresses stored in the EZ Multiplexer and will write new values to the EZ Multiplexer The EZ Multiplexer will constantly monitor the PLCs for all of the active stored programmed addresses By doing so the EZ Multiplexer will always have updated information for an EZText Panel request Plea
